SITE Doubles Platform Usage & New Customers Over The Last Year
I’m pleased to announce that over the past 12 months, SITE has experienced remarkable growth in our customer base as well as overall platform usage. These milestones are a powerful testament that organizations are increasingly turning to SITE to simplify capital planning, optimize resources, and unlock actionable insights across their property portfolios.
Behind these milestones is a collective effort across the SITE team:
- Our technology and engineering teams have relentlessly innovated to build a powerful, reliable, and user-friendly platform
- Our customer success team has worked tirelessly to nurture strong relationships and ensure customers get maximum value from the platform
- Our leadership team has championed our vision and spread the word about the innovative technology SITE is bringing to the industry
Our platform combines advanced AI-driven analytics and in-house engineers to empower property owners, asset managers, and facility teams with the tools they need to make smarter decisions. From predictive maintenance and risk mitigation to comprehensive capital planning, we deliver clarity where it matters most across your entire portfolio.
And we’re not slowing down. This level of adoption signals a clear message that the CRE is ready for remote assessment capabilities to help them make safer and smarter decisions.
We’re excited about the future of SITE and will be building upon the foundation of our pavement and roof assessments by adding in landscape and facade assessments as well as the capabilities to view your facilities in 3D. The next version of SITE will truly allow our users to be able to plan capital at the facility level across every major trade as well as “walk their property” from the safety of their desk.
